Place the four steps for computing the correlation coefficient into the correct order: 1. Add up the cross-products of the Z scores. 2. Change all scores to Z scores. 3. Divide by the number of people in the study. 4. Figure the cross-product of the Z scores for each person.

A.2, 1, 4, 3

B.4, 3, 1, 2

C.2, 4, 1, 3

D.1, 2, 3, 4

Solution: The correct order is:

2. Change all scores to Z-scores

4. Figure the cross-product of the Z-scores for each person.

1. Add up the cross-products of the Z scores.

3. Divide by the number of people in the study.

Therefore, the correct option is C. 2, 4, 1, 3
